SVG Ventures Announces 2026 THRIVE Global Impact Summit


SVG Ventures continues its mission to accelerate innovation in food, agriculture, and climate with its latest global event, bringing together startups, corporates, investors, and industry leaders from across the agri-food ecosystem.
The 2026 THRIVE Global Impact Summit organized by SVG Ventures is set to bring together over 400 innovators, investors, and industry leaders focused on advancing sustainability in food and agriculture. Scheduled for October 15, 2026, the summit will feature expert-led panels, curated startup showcases, and high-impact networking designed to catalyze collaboration and accelerate solutions for a more resilient, climate-positive future.
The event serves as a platform for collaboration and knowledge exchange, highlighting emerging technologies and scalable solutions addressing sustainability, resilience, and climate impact across the value chain.
Participants gain insights from expert speakers, engage in thought-provoking panel discussions, and explore cutting-edge innovations presented by startups shaping the future of agriculture and food systems. The program emphasizes practical applications, real-world case studies, and opportunities for strategic partnerships that can drive measurable impact.
As part of SVG Ventures’ broader THRIVE initiative, the event reinforces the organization’s commitment to supporting breakthrough innovation and fostering connections that enable long-term transformation of the global agri-food sector.
